Output 59c71b73f69f09ca8305a5404eb5a0f2880ca2ef6337a92e58df79f7c9cdd474:1

value
522415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18edd8a61e4c9525cc1cb4ad2c8f86555592daa1 OP_EQUAL
address
33xq4zo4QbNUzpw8cFvGS1sxp7KxrMSSUo
transaction
59c71b73f69f09ca8305a5404eb5a0f2880ca2ef6337a92e58df79f7c9cdd474
spent
true